你查询的IP:[60.243.246.228]  地理位置:印度Hathway网络用户

最新查询116.66.212.155 124.68.142.170 124.128.69.150 118.144.225.25 124.224.11.157 211.160.63.186 203.94.181.235 116.242.175.77 202.120.192.209 60.243.246.228 116.198.151.159 202.38.136.90 122.248.48.90 118.80.133.25 59.191.240.3 124.200.167.214 202.165.96.232 121.100.128.156 117.124.194.246 202.93.252.225 123.176.80.147 203.91.120.66 124.67.164.195 118.126.234.64 202.127.216.4 210.192.96.20 119.42.136.56 221.12.197.170 202.69.16.35 202.136.224.120 211.136.42.139